DEV Community

Programming

The magic behind computers. 💻 🪄

Posts

👋 Sign in for the ability to sort posts by relevant, latest, or top.
Debugging Your RAG Application: A LangChain, Python, and OpenAI Tutorial

Debugging Your RAG Application: A LangChain, Python, and OpenAI Tutorial

Comments
5 min read
JS to style radio button list

JS to style radio button list

Comments 1
2 min read
Benefits of JavaScript Code Snippets for Web Developers

Benefits of JavaScript Code Snippets for Web Developers

Comments
5 min read
Navigating Financial Insights: Analyzing Stock Data with Python and Visualization

Navigating Financial Insights: Analyzing Stock Data with Python and Visualization

1
Comments
2 min read
If You Give A Seed A Fertilizer

If You Give A Seed A Fertilizer

1
Comments
4 min read
Experience of building a complete? font optimization package for Astro websites

Experience of building a complete? font optimization package for Astro websites

6
Comments
2 min read
Elegância Funcional: Redescobrindo JavaScript Através da Programação Funcional

Elegância Funcional: Redescobrindo JavaScript Através da Programação Funcional

Comments
15 min read
Dev Recap: A Look Back at 2023 in Coding and Open‐Source Development

Dev Recap: A Look Back at 2023 in Coding and Open‐Source Development

4
Comments
5 min read
Resources I wish I knew when I started my career

Resources I wish I knew when I started my career

199
Comments 12
3 min read
Discussion: What is the best programming language to learn in 2024?

Discussion: What is the best programming language to learn in 2024?

34
Comments 33
1 min read
Simplifying Dependency Management in Node.js with Container Libraries

Simplifying Dependency Management in Node.js with Container Libraries

Comments
3 min read
Real-Time Updates in MERN Applications with Server-Sent Events

Real-Time Updates in MERN Applications with Server-Sent Events

2
Comments 2
2 min read
Understanding the Event Loop in JavaScript

Understanding the Event Loop in JavaScript

6
Comments
2 min read
Maximizando la Productividad: Cómo Finalizar tu Jornada de Desarrollo de Software de Manera Efectiva

Maximizando la Productividad: Cómo Finalizar tu Jornada de Desarrollo de Software de Manera Efectiva

8
Comments 2
2 min read
StyleX Facebook Style Library Killer of Tailwind CSS

StyleX Facebook Style Library Killer of Tailwind CSS

1
Comments
3 min read
Geared up for success in 2024

Geared up for success in 2024

1
Comments
3 min read
My 2024 PDE: NeoVim

My 2024 PDE: NeoVim

5
Comments
5 min read
Maximizing Productivity: How to Effectively End Your Software Development Workday

Maximizing Productivity: How to Effectively End Your Software Development Workday

9
Comments
2 min read
Como usar requestAnimationFrame() com vanilla JS

Como usar requestAnimationFrame() com vanilla JS

Comments
2 min read
How to Lower the Cost of Changing Software - Part 1

How to Lower the Cost of Changing Software - Part 1

1
Comments
7 min read
Developer's Cheat Sheet: 10 Game-Changing Git Commands 🚀

Developer's Cheat Sheet: 10 Game-Changing Git Commands 🚀

6
Comments
7 min read
How To Create a Age Calculator in HTML CSS & JavaScript [Calculate Age from Date of Birth]

How To Create a Age Calculator in HTML CSS & JavaScript [Calculate Age from Date of Birth]

Comments
9 min read
Demystifying OOP in C#: Your Guide to Building Robust and Flexible Applications

Demystifying OOP in C#: Your Guide to Building Robust and Flexible Applications

Comments
3 min read
Como atualizar a URL do navegador sem refresh a página usando a vanilla JS History API

Como atualizar a URL do navegador sem refresh a página usando a vanilla JS History API

Comments
3 min read
Por que utilizar um elemento form quando submit campos com JavaScript?

Por que utilizar um elemento form quando submit campos com JavaScript?

Comments
2 min read
Super Mario

Super Mario

1
Comments
1 min read
SQL vs NoSQL: Choosing the Right database for Your Project

SQL vs NoSQL: Choosing the Right database for Your Project

15
Comments 5
2 min read
React JS Jobs, Roles, Salary and More

React JS Jobs, Roles, Salary and More

Comments
5 min read
Embracing the Coding Rollercoaster with Mimo: A Love Letter to Syntax Sanity

Embracing the Coding Rollercoaster with Mimo: A Love Letter to Syntax Sanity

Comments
2 min read
Webinar: Solving the Integration Testing Puzzle with Contract Testing [Voices Of Community]

Webinar: Solving the Integration Testing Puzzle with Contract Testing [Voices Of Community]

Comments
10 min read
How to Use Pyinstaller to Generate an EXE File

How to Use Pyinstaller to Generate an EXE File

Comments
3 min read
Balancing Codes and Mental Wellbeing: A Guide for Software Engineers

Balancing Codes and Mental Wellbeing: A Guide for Software Engineers

Comments
2 min read
C# - Record Structs for Immutable Value Types

C# - Record Structs for Immutable Value Types

Comments
1 min read
Linux operating system and basic of shell scripting

Linux operating system and basic of shell scripting

7
Comments
2 min read
A holiday gift: "inspect" dialog for Mini Micro

A holiday gift: "inspect" dialog for Mini Micro

Comments
2 min read
Gatsby Site Search Plugin

Gatsby Site Search Plugin

6
Comments 1
4 min read
SQL - Efficiently Paginate Query Results

SQL - Efficiently Paginate Query Results

Comments
1 min read
Struggling to choose a programming language? This guide will help you.

Struggling to choose a programming language? This guide will help you.

1
Comments
1 min read
Character encoding

Character encoding

6
Comments
6 min read
Christmas Gift from Serverspace. Grab $100 and begin your Cloud Journey

Christmas Gift from Serverspace. Grab $100 and begin your Cloud Journey

5
Comments
1 min read
The Must have Chrome Extension While applying for your dream job

The Must have Chrome Extension While applying for your dream job

Comments
2 min read
Unison: From 0 to Cloud

Unison: From 0 to Cloud

Comments
8 min read
Shopping for healthy nutrition is like looking for the most appropriate programming tools.

Shopping for healthy nutrition is like looking for the most appropriate programming tools.

1
Comments 2
2 min read
Introduction to Ruby's Enumerable Module

Introduction to Ruby's Enumerable Module

Comments
2 min read
Use Asynchronous Programming in Python: Don’t Block entire Thread

Use Asynchronous Programming in Python: Don’t Block entire Thread

2
Comments
4 min read
TypeScript: The Unexpected Magic of Generics

TypeScript: The Unexpected Magic of Generics

5
Comments
3 min read
Difference between php-session vs tokens

Difference between php-session vs tokens

Comments
2 min read
Different Levels of Project Documentation

Different Levels of Project Documentation

1
Comments
7 min read
Variable scope in C programming.

Variable scope in C programming.

5
Comments
1 min read
What factors should be considered when deciding between using PHP sessions or tokens in a web development project?

What factors should be considered when deciding between using PHP sessions or tokens in a web development project?

Comments 1
2 min read
Personal Roadmap for becoming a better software developer in 2024

Personal Roadmap for becoming a better software developer in 2024

112
Comments 62
2 min read
Modern Web App - Start of the Journey

Modern Web App - Start of the Journey

Comments
4 min read
Making Our Tasks Classy

Making Our Tasks Classy

2
Comments
6 min read
Building .NET 8 APIs with Zero-Setup CQRS and Vertical Slice Architecture

Building .NET 8 APIs with Zero-Setup CQRS and Vertical Slice Architecture

6
Comments 3
3 min read
The first month in CS Diploma

The first month in CS Diploma

Comments
1 min read
Exploring AI-Powered Codebase Migration: A Developer's Journey

Exploring AI-Powered Codebase Migration: A Developer's Journey

Comments 1
3 min read
Refactorización de código JavaScript: Eficiencia con Set y Map

Refactorización de código JavaScript: Eficiencia con Set y Map

17
Comments
3 min read
Tailwind vs Bootstrap: A Developer's Dilemma

Tailwind vs Bootstrap: A Developer's Dilemma

Comments
2 min read
SQL vs NoSQL: Elegir la Base de Datos Adecuada para su Proyecto

SQL vs NoSQL: Elegir la Base de Datos Adecuada para su Proyecto

7
Comments
2 min read
Entendendo Java Stream API na prática

Entendendo Java Stream API na prática

1
Comments
9 min read
loading...